다음을 통해 공유


UserPermissionObject 인터페이스

현재 양식의 Permission 컬렉션 구성원을 나타냅니다.

네임스페이스: Microsoft.Office.Interop.InfoPath
어셈블리: Microsoft.Office.Interop.InfoPath(microsoft.office.interop.infopath.dll)

구문

<GuidAttribute("096CD6CB-0786-11D1-95FA-0080C78EE3BB")> _
<CoClassAttribute(GetType(UserPermissionObjectClass))> _
Public Interface UserPermissionObject
    Inherits UserPermission

Dim instance As UserPermissionObject
[GuidAttribute("096CD6CB-0786-11D1-95FA-0080C78EE3BB")] 
[CoClassAttribute(typeof(UserPermissionObjectClass))] 
public interface UserPermissionObject : UserPermission

주의

이 형식은 COM 상호 운용성을 위해 관리 코드에 필요한 coclass에 대한 래퍼입니다. 이 coclass에 의해 구현되는 COM 인터페이스의 구성원에 액세스하려면 이 형식을 사용하십시오. 해당 구성원의 설명에 대한 링크를 비롯한 COM 인터페이스에 대한 자세한 내용은 다음을 참고하십시오. UserPermission.

UserPermissionObject 개체는 현재 양식에 대한 권한 집합을 단일 사용자 및 선택적 만료 날짜와 연결합니다.

UserPermission 클래스의 속성을 사용하여 사용자 및 해당 사용자와 연결된 권한을 정의한 다음, Permission 개체의 Add 메서드를 사용하여 현재 양식에 대한 사용자 권한을 추가 및 부여합니다. 사용자 및 사용자 권한을 제거하려면 UserPermission 개체의 Remove 메서드를 사용합니다.

사용자 인터페이스를 통해 부여되는 일부 권한(예: 인쇄 및 만료 날짜)은 모든 사용자에게 적용할 수 있지만 UserPermission 개체를 사용하여 만료 날짜가 사용자마다 다른 사용자 단위의 권한을 할당할 수 있습니다.

참고 항목

참조

UserPermissionObject 구성원
Microsoft.Office.Interop.InfoPath 네임스페이스